Leicester City chairman Milan Mandaric today delivered the perfect Christmas present to Foxes fans when he announced the news that Matty Fryatt had signed a new three-and-a-half year contract with the club.

The 22-year-old striker has become one of the most talked about players in the Football League - bagging an incredible 23 goals for the season to date.
